LPEX
4.4.0

com.ibm.lpex.cc
Interface FortranFreeFormConstants

All Known Implementing Classes:
FortranFreeFormTokenManager, FreeFormLexer

public interface FortranFreeFormConstants


Field Summary
static int _DEFAULT
           
static int _INTEGER
           
static int _LOGICAL
           
static int _NAME
           
static int _NUMBER
           
static int ACCESS
           
static int ACTION
           
static int ADVANCE
           
static int ALLOCATABLE
           
static int ALLOCATE
           
static int AMPERSAND
           
static int AMPERSAND_CONT
           
static int AND
           
static int ANY_CHAR
           
static int APPEND
           
static int ASIS
           
static int ASSIGN
           
static int ASSIGNMENT
           
static int AUTOMATIC
           
static int BACKSPACE
           
static int BINARY_CONSTANT
           
static int BLANK
           
static int BLOCKDATA
           
static int BYTE
           
static int CALL
           
static int CASE
           
static int CHARACTER
           
static int CLOSE
           
static int COMMON
           
static int COMPLEX
           
static int CONTAINS
           
static int CONTINUE
           
static int CYCLE
           
static int DATA
           
static int DEALLOCATE
           
static int DEFAULT
           
static int DELIM
           
static int DIGIT
           
static int DIMENSION
           
static int DIRECT
           
static int DO
           
static int DOUBLE
           
static int DOUBLECOMPLEX
           
static int DOUBLEPRECISION
           
static int DOWHILE
           
static int EJECT
           
static int ELEMENTAL
           
static int ELSE
           
static int ELSEIF
           
static int ELSEWHERE
           
static int END
           
static int ENDBLOCKDATA
           
static int ENDDO
           
static int ENDFILE
           
static int ENDFORALL
           
static int ENDFUNCTION
           
static int ENDIF
           
static int ENDINTERFACE
           
static int ENDMODULE
           
static int ENDPROGRAM
           
static int ENDSELECT
           
static int ENDSUBROUTINE
           
static int ENDTYPE
           
static int ENDWHERE
           
static int ENTRY
           
static int EOF
           
static int EOL
           
static int EOR
           
static int EQ
           
static int EQUIVALENCE
           
static int EQV
           
static int ERR
           
static int ERROR_LINE
           
static int EXIST
           
static int EXIT
           
static int EXPONENT
           
static int EXTERNAL
           
static int EXTRINSIC
           
static int FILE
           
static int FMT
           
static int FORALL
           
static int FORM
           
static int FORMAT
           
static int FORMATTED
           
static int FUNCTION
           
static int GE
           
static int GO
           
static int GOTO
           
static int GT
           
static int HEX_CONSTANT
           
static int HEXDIGIT
           
static int HOLLERITH_CONSTANT
           
static int HPF
           
static int HPF_LOCAL
           
static int HPF_SERIAL
           
static int IF
           
static int IMPLICIT
           
static int IN
           
static int IN_COMMENT
           
static int IN_DOUBLEQUOTE
           
static int IN_SINGLEQUOTE
           
static int INCLUDE
           
static int INOUT
           
static int INQUIRE
           
static int INTEGER
           
static int INTENT
           
static int INTERFACE
           
static int INTRINSIC
           
static int IOLENGTH
           
static int IOSTAT
           
static int KIND
           
static int LE
           
static int LEN
           
static int LETTER
           
static int LOGICAL
           
static int LPAREN
           
static int LT
           
static int MODULE
           
static int MODULEPROCEDURE
           
static int NAME
           
static int NAMED
           
static int NAMELIST
           
static int NE
           
static int NEQV
           
static int NEXTREC
           
static int NML
           
static int NONE
           
static int NOT
           
static int NULLIFY
           
static int NUM
           
static int NUMBER
           
static int OCTAL_CONSTANT
           
static int ONLY
           
static int OPEN
           
static int OPENED
           
static int OPERATOR
           
static int OPTIONAL
           
static int OR
           
static int OUT
           
static int PAD
           
static int PARAMETER
           
static int PAUSE
           
static int POINTER
           
static int POSITION
           
static int PRECISION
           
static int PRINT
           
static int PRIVATE
           
static int PROCEDURE
           
static int PROCESS
           
static int PROGRAM
           
static int PUBLIC
           
static int PUNCTUATION
           
static int PURE
           
static int Q1
           
static int Q2
           
static int QA
           
static int QB
           
static int READ
           
static int READWRITE
           
static int REAL
           
static int REC
           
static int RECL
           
static int RECURSIVE
           
static int REF
           
static int RESULT
           
static int RETURN
           
static int REWIND
           
static int RPAREN
           
static int SAVE
           
static int SELECT
           
static int SELECTCASE
           
static int SEMICOLON
           
static int SEQUENCE
           
static int SEQUENTIAL
           
static int SHAPE
           
static int SIZE
           
static int SOURCEFORM
           
static int STAT
           
static int STATIC
           
static int STATUS
           
static int STOP
           
static int SUBROUTINE
           
static int TARGET
           
static int THEN
           
static int TO
           
static String[] tokenImage
           
static int TYPE
           
static int UNFORMATTED
           
static int UNIT
           
static int USE
           
static int VAL
           
static int VIRTUAL
           
static int VOLATILE
           
static int WAIT
           
static int WHERE
           
static int WHITE_SPACE
           
static int WRITE
           
static int XOR
           
 

Field Detail

EOF

static final int EOF
See Also:
Constant Field Values

EOL

static final int EOL
See Also:
Constant Field Values

ASSIGNMENT

static final int ASSIGNMENT
See Also:
Constant Field Values

BLOCKDATA

static final int BLOCKDATA
See Also:
Constant Field Values

ELEMENTAL

static final int ELEMENTAL
See Also:
Constant Field Values

ENDBLOCKDATA

static final int ENDBLOCKDATA
See Also:
Constant Field Values

ENDFUNCTION

static final int ENDFUNCTION
See Also:
Constant Field Values

ENDINTERFACE

static final int ENDINTERFACE
See Also:
Constant Field Values

ENDMODULE

static final int ENDMODULE
See Also:
Constant Field Values

ENDPROGRAM

static final int ENDPROGRAM
See Also:
Constant Field Values

ENDSUBROUTINE

static final int ENDSUBROUTINE
See Also:
Constant Field Values

ENTRY

static final int ENTRY
See Also:
Constant Field Values

EXTRINSIC

static final int EXTRINSIC
See Also:
Constant Field Values

FUNCTION

static final int FUNCTION
See Also:
Constant Field Values

MODULE

static final int MODULE
See Also:
Constant Field Values

OPERATOR

static final int OPERATOR
See Also:
Constant Field Values

PROCEDURE

static final int PROCEDURE
See Also:
Constant Field Values

PROGRAM

static final int PROGRAM
See Also:
Constant Field Values

PURE

static final int PURE
See Also:
Constant Field Values

RECURSIVE

static final int RECURSIVE
See Also:
Constant Field Values

RESULT

static final int RESULT
See Also:
Constant Field Values

SUBROUTINE

static final int SUBROUTINE
See Also:
Constant Field Values

VAL

static final int VAL
See Also:
Constant Field Values

REF

static final int REF
See Also:
Constant Field Values

ALLOCATABLE

static final int ALLOCATABLE
See Also:
Constant Field Values

AUTOMATIC

static final int AUTOMATIC
See Also:
Constant Field Values

BYTE

static final int BYTE
See Also:
Constant Field Values

CHARACTER

static final int CHARACTER
See Also:
Constant Field Values

COMMON

static final int COMMON
See Also:
Constant Field Values

COMPLEX

static final int COMPLEX
See Also:
Constant Field Values

DATA

static final int DATA
See Also:
Constant Field Values

DIMENSION

static final int DIMENSION
See Also:
Constant Field Values

DOUBLE

static final int DOUBLE
See Also:
Constant Field Values

DOUBLECOMPLEX

static final int DOUBLECOMPLEX
See Also:
Constant Field Values

DOUBLEPRECISION

static final int DOUBLEPRECISION
See Also:
Constant Field Values

EJECT

static final int EJECT
See Also:
Constant Field Values

ENDTYPE

static final int ENDTYPE
See Also:
Constant Field Values

EQUIVALENCE

static final int EQUIVALENCE
See Also:
Constant Field Values

EXTERNAL

static final int EXTERNAL
See Also:
Constant Field Values

HPF

static final int HPF
See Also:
Constant Field Values

HPF_LOCAL

static final int HPF_LOCAL
See Also:
Constant Field Values

HPF_SERIAL

static final int HPF_SERIAL
See Also:
Constant Field Values

IMPLICIT

static final int IMPLICIT
See Also:
Constant Field Values

IN

static final int IN
See Also:
Constant Field Values

INCLUDE

static final int INCLUDE
See Also:
Constant Field Values

INOUT

static final int INOUT
See Also:
Constant Field Values

_INTEGER

static final int _INTEGER
See Also:
Constant Field Values

INTENT

static final int INTENT
See Also:
Constant Field Values

INTRINSIC

static final int INTRINSIC
See Also:
Constant Field Values

KIND

static final int KIND
See Also:
Constant Field Values

LEN

static final int LEN
See Also:
Constant Field Values

_LOGICAL

static final int _LOGICAL
See Also:
Constant Field Values

MODULEPROCEDURE

static final int MODULEPROCEDURE
See Also:
Constant Field Values

NAMELIST

static final int NAMELIST
See Also:
Constant Field Values

NONE

static final int NONE
See Also:
Constant Field Values

ONLY

static final int ONLY
See Also:
Constant Field Values

OPTIONAL

static final int OPTIONAL
See Also:
Constant Field Values

OUT

static final int OUT
See Also:
Constant Field Values

PARAMETER

static final int PARAMETER
See Also:
Constant Field Values

POINTER

static final int POINTER
See Also:
Constant Field Values

PRECISION

static final int PRECISION
See Also:
Constant Field Values

PRIVATE

static final int PRIVATE
See Also:
Constant Field Values

PUBLIC

static final int PUBLIC
See Also:
Constant Field Values

REAL

static final int REAL
See Also:
Constant Field Values

SAVE

static final int SAVE
See Also:
Constant Field Values

SEQUENCE

static final int SEQUENCE
See Also:
Constant Field Values

SOURCEFORM

static final int SOURCEFORM
See Also:
Constant Field Values

STATIC

static final int STATIC
See Also:
Constant Field Values

TARGET

static final int TARGET
See Also:
Constant Field Values

TYPE

static final int TYPE
See Also:
Constant Field Values

USE

static final int USE
See Also:
Constant Field Values

VIRTUAL

static final int VIRTUAL
See Also:
Constant Field Values

VOLATILE

static final int VOLATILE
See Also:
Constant Field Values

ACCESS

static final int ACCESS
See Also:
Constant Field Values

ACTION

static final int ACTION
See Also:
Constant Field Values

ADVANCE

static final int ADVANCE
See Also:
Constant Field Values

ALLOCATE

static final int ALLOCATE
See Also:
Constant Field Values

APPEND

static final int APPEND
See Also:
Constant Field Values

ASIS

static final int ASIS
See Also:
Constant Field Values

ASSIGN

static final int ASSIGN
See Also:
Constant Field Values

BACKSPACE

static final int BACKSPACE
See Also:
Constant Field Values

BLANK

static final int BLANK
See Also:
Constant Field Values

CALL

static final int CALL
See Also:
Constant Field Values

CASE

static final int CASE
See Also:
Constant Field Values

CLOSE

static final int CLOSE
See Also:
Constant Field Values

CONTAINS

static final int CONTAINS
See Also:
Constant Field Values

CONTINUE

static final int CONTINUE
See Also:
Constant Field Values

CYCLE

static final int CYCLE
See Also:
Constant Field Values

DEALLOCATE

static final int DEALLOCATE
See Also:
Constant Field Values

_DEFAULT

static final int _DEFAULT
See Also:
Constant Field Values

DELIM

static final int DELIM
See Also:
Constant Field Values

DIRECT

static final int DIRECT
See Also:
Constant Field Values

DO

static final int DO
See Also:
Constant Field Values

DOWHILE

static final int DOWHILE
See Also:
Constant Field Values

ELSE

static final int ELSE
See Also:
Constant Field Values

ELSEIF

static final int ELSEIF
See Also:
Constant Field Values

ELSEWHERE

static final int ELSEWHERE
See Also:
Constant Field Values

ENDDO

static final int ENDDO
See Also:
Constant Field Values

ENDFILE

static final int ENDFILE
See Also:
Constant Field Values

ENDFORALL

static final int ENDFORALL
See Also:
Constant Field Values

ENDIF

static final int ENDIF
See Also:
Constant Field Values

ENDSELECT

static final int ENDSELECT
See Also:
Constant Field Values

ENDWHERE

static final int ENDWHERE
See Also:
Constant Field Values

EOR

static final int EOR
See Also:
Constant Field Values

ERR

static final int ERR
See Also:
Constant Field Values

EXIST

static final int EXIST
See Also:
Constant Field Values

EXIT

static final int EXIT
See Also:
Constant Field Values

FILE

static final int FILE
See Also:
Constant Field Values

FMT

static final int FMT
See Also:
Constant Field Values

FORALL

static final int FORALL
See Also:
Constant Field Values

FORM

static final int FORM
See Also:
Constant Field Values

FORMATTED

static final int FORMATTED
See Also:
Constant Field Values

GO

static final int GO
See Also:
Constant Field Values

GOTO

static final int GOTO
See Also:
Constant Field Values

IF

static final int IF
See Also:
Constant Field Values

INQUIRE

static final int INQUIRE
See Also:
Constant Field Values

INTERFACE

static final int INTERFACE
See Also:
Constant Field Values

IOLENGTH

static final int IOLENGTH
See Also:
Constant Field Values

IOSTAT

static final int IOSTAT
See Also:
Constant Field Values

_NAME

static final int _NAME
See Also:
Constant Field Values

NAMED

static final int NAMED
See Also:
Constant Field Values

NEXTREC

static final int NEXTREC
See Also:
Constant Field Values

NML

static final int NML
See Also:
Constant Field Values

NULLIFY

static final int NULLIFY
See Also:
Constant Field Values

NUM

static final int NUM
See Also:
Constant Field Values

_NUMBER

static final int _NUMBER
See Also:
Constant Field Values

OPEN

static final int OPEN
See Also:
Constant Field Values

OPENED

static final int OPENED
See Also:
Constant Field Values

PAD

static final int PAD
See Also:
Constant Field Values

PAUSE

static final int PAUSE
See Also:
Constant Field Values

POSITION

static final int POSITION
See Also:
Constant Field Values

PRINT

static final int PRINT
See Also:
Constant Field Values

READ

static final int READ
See Also:
Constant Field Values

READWRITE

static final int READWRITE
See Also:
Constant Field Values

REC

static final int REC
See Also:
Constant Field Values

RECL

static final int RECL
See Also:
Constant Field Values

RETURN

static final int RETURN
See Also:
Constant Field Values

REWIND

static final int REWIND
See Also:
Constant Field Values

SELECT

static final int SELECT
See Also:
Constant Field Values

SELECTCASE

static final int SELECTCASE
See Also:
Constant Field Values

SEQUENTIAL

static final int SEQUENTIAL
See Also:
Constant Field Values

SHAPE

static final int SHAPE
See Also:
Constant Field Values

SIZE

static final int SIZE
See Also:
Constant Field Values

STAT

static final int STAT
See Also:
Constant Field Values

STATUS

static final int STATUS
See Also:
Constant Field Values

STOP

static final int STOP
See Also:
Constant Field Values

THEN

static final int THEN
See Also:
Constant Field Values

TO

static final int TO
See Also:
Constant Field Values

UNFORMATTED

static final int UNFORMATTED
See Also:
Constant Field Values

UNIT

static final int UNIT
See Also:
Constant Field Values

WAIT

static final int WAIT
See Also:
Constant Field Values

WHERE

static final int WHERE
See Also:
Constant Field Values

WRITE

static final int WRITE
See Also:
Constant Field Values

END

static final int END
See Also:
Constant Field Values

FORMAT

static final int FORMAT
See Also:
Constant Field Values

PROCESS

static final int PROCESS
See Also:
Constant Field Values

AND

static final int AND
See Also:
Constant Field Values

EQ

static final int EQ
See Also:
Constant Field Values

EQV

static final int EQV
See Also:
Constant Field Values

GE

static final int GE
See Also:
Constant Field Values

GT

static final int GT
See Also:
Constant Field Values

LE

static final int LE
See Also:
Constant Field Values

LT

static final int LT
See Also:
Constant Field Values

NE

static final int NE
See Also:
Constant Field Values

NEQV

static final int NEQV
See Also:
Constant Field Values

NOT

static final int NOT
See Also:
Constant Field Values

OR

static final int OR
See Also:
Constant Field Values

XOR

static final int XOR
See Also:
Constant Field Values

LOGICAL

static final int LOGICAL
See Also:
Constant Field Values

PUNCTUATION

static final int PUNCTUATION
See Also:
Constant Field Values

LPAREN

static final int LPAREN
See Also:
Constant Field Values

RPAREN

static final int RPAREN
See Also:
Constant Field Values

SEMICOLON

static final int SEMICOLON
See Also:
Constant Field Values

HEX_CONSTANT

static final int HEX_CONSTANT
See Also:
Constant Field Values

HEXDIGIT

static final int HEXDIGIT
See Also:
Constant Field Values

OCTAL_CONSTANT

static final int OCTAL_CONSTANT
See Also:
Constant Field Values

BINARY_CONSTANT

static final int BINARY_CONSTANT
See Also:
Constant Field Values

HOLLERITH_CONSTANT

static final int HOLLERITH_CONSTANT
See Also:
Constant Field Values

INTEGER

static final int INTEGER
See Also:
Constant Field Values

NUMBER

static final int NUMBER
See Also:
Constant Field Values

EXPONENT

static final int EXPONENT
See Also:
Constant Field Values

LETTER

static final int LETTER
See Also:
Constant Field Values

DIGIT

static final int DIGIT
See Also:
Constant Field Values

WHITE_SPACE

static final int WHITE_SPACE
See Also:
Constant Field Values

NAME

static final int NAME
See Also:
Constant Field Values

AMPERSAND_CONT

static final int AMPERSAND_CONT
See Also:
Constant Field Values

AMPERSAND

static final int AMPERSAND
See Also:
Constant Field Values

Q1

static final int Q1
See Also:
Constant Field Values

QA

static final int QA
See Also:
Constant Field Values

Q2

static final int Q2
See Also:
Constant Field Values

QB

static final int QB
See Also:
Constant Field Values

ANY_CHAR

static final int ANY_CHAR
See Also:
Constant Field Values

DEFAULT

static final int DEFAULT
See Also:
Constant Field Values

IN_COMMENT

static final int IN_COMMENT
See Also:
Constant Field Values

ERROR_LINE

static final int ERROR_LINE
See Also:
Constant Field Values

IN_SINGLEQUOTE

static final int IN_SINGLEQUOTE
See Also:
Constant Field Values

IN_DOUBLEQUOTE

static final int IN_DOUBLEQUOTE
See Also:
Constant Field Values

tokenImage

static final String[] tokenImage

LPEX
4.4.0

Copyright � 2016 IBM Corp. All Rights Reserved.

Note: This documentation is for part of an interim API that is still under development and expected to change significantly before reaching stability. It is being made available at this early stage to solicit feedback from pioneering adopters on the understanding that any code that uses this API will almost certainly be broken (repeatedly) as the API evolves.